ttk-cli / uni-vue3-vite-ts-pinia

A template for uniapp with vue3.
MIT License
331 stars 100 forks source link

chore(deps): update dependency eslint-plugin-vue to v7.20.0 #21

Closed renovate[bot] closed 1 year ago

renovate[bot] commented 2 years ago

Mend Renovate

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
eslint-plugin-vue (source) 7.0.0 -> 7.20.0 age adoption passing confidence

Release Notes

vuejs/eslint-plugin-vue ### [`v7.20.0`](https://togithub.com/vuejs/eslint-plugin-vue/releases/tag/v7.20.0) [Compare Source](https://togithub.com/vuejs/eslint-plugin-vue/compare/v7.19.1...v7.20.0) #### ✨ Enhancements - [#​1472](https://togithub.com/vuejs/eslint-plugin-vue/issues/1472) Added `vue/no-undef-properties` rule that warns of using undefined properties. - [#​1653](https://togithub.com/vuejs/eslint-plugin-vue/issues/1653) Added `vue/no-computed-properties-in-data` rule that disallow accessing computed properties in `data()`. - [#​1659](https://togithub.com/vuejs/eslint-plugin-vue/issues/1659) Improved `vue/no-use-computed-property-like-method` rule reports. - [#​1661](https://togithub.com/vuejs/eslint-plugin-vue/issues/1661) Added `vue/multi-word-component-names` rule to enforce multiple words in component names. - [#​1663](https://togithub.com/vuejs/eslint-plugin-vue/issues/1663) Added `vue/no-deprecated-router-link-tag-prop` rule that disallow using deprecated `tag` property on ``. #### 🐛 Bug Fixes - [#​1659](https://togithub.com/vuejs/eslint-plugin-vue/issues/1659) Fixed crash in `vue/no-use-computed-property-like-method` rule. - [#​1658](https://togithub.com/vuejs/eslint-plugin-vue/issues/1658) Fixed false positives for vars inside types in `vue/valid-define-emits` and `vue/valid-define-props` rules. #### ⚙️ Updates - [#​1654](https://togithub.com/vuejs/eslint-plugin-vue/issues/1654) Changed peer deps eslint ver from `^6.2.0 || ^7.0.0 || ^8.0.0-0` to `^6.2.0 || ^7.0.0 || ^8.0.0`. **Full Changelog**: https://github.com/vuejs/eslint-plugin-vue/compare/v7.19.1...v7.20.0 ### [`v7.19.1`](https://togithub.com/vuejs/eslint-plugin-vue/releases/tag/v7.19.1) [Compare Source](https://togithub.com/vuejs/eslint-plugin-vue/compare/v7.19.0...v7.19.1) #### :bug: Bug Fixes - \[[`83eab8d`](https://togithub.com/vuejs/eslint-plugin-vue/commit/83eab8d2)] Fixed false positives for vars inside functions in `vue/valid-define-emits` and `vue/valid-define-props` rules. Picked from [#​1652](https://togithub.com/vuejs/eslint-plugin-vue/issues/1652) *** **Full Changelog**: https://github.com/vuejs/eslint-plugin-vue/compare/v7.19.0...v7.19.1 ### [`v7.19.0`](https://togithub.com/vuejs/eslint-plugin-vue/releases/tag/v7.19.0) [Compare Source](https://togithub.com/vuejs/eslint-plugin-vue/compare/v7.18.0...v7.19.0) #### ✨ Enhancements - [#​1639](https://togithub.com/vuejs/eslint-plugin-vue/issues/1639) Added `vue/no-restricted-class` rule that reports the classes you don't want to allow in the template. - [#​1644](https://togithub.com/vuejs/eslint-plugin-vue/issues/1644) Added `vue/no-useless-template-attributes` rule that disallow useless attribute on `